Output 75f9c16d2b8fe6f659d5b13ca204e4e3d02cbab69cf4bfe34abc0c91f9b6e4df:11

value
12423662
script pubkey
OP_0 OP_PUSHBYTES_32 554d40aec18cd4eecfa4064f5c83775e76dc97b005b772f0c78d239bc3deba80
address
bc1q24x5ptkp3n2wanayqe84eqmhtemde9asqkmh9ux8353ehs77h2qq4mgw7r
transaction
75f9c16d2b8fe6f659d5b13ca204e4e3d02cbab69cf4bfe34abc0c91f9b6e4df
spent
true